Islamic brotherhoods in Senegal have an annual celebration of the birth of Mohammed, called here a Gammu. The date is pretty flexible, which means that if you want, you can attend multiple Gammus in multiple places. We in the field call this ‘hitting the Gammu Circuit’. I hit it hard.
